Leon E. Schrader, 88, of Andalusia, passed away Saturday, August 10, 2024, at his residence.

Funeral services will be held at 1:30 p.m. Friday, August 16, 2024, at Wheelan-Pressly Funeral Home and Crematory, 201 E. 4th Avenue, Milan. Visitation will be held one hour prior from 12:30 to 1:30 p.m. Friday at the funeral home. Burial will be in Illinois City Cemetery. Memorials may be made to the Andalusia Volunteer Ambulance.

Leon was born August 13, 1935, in Delmar, Iowa, to Howard A. and Juanita (Burke) Schrader. He graduated from Delmar High School in 1952. Leon married Marietta Dusenberry on June 4, 1960. She preceded him in death on April 21, 2023. Leon retired from Alcoa in 1997 after working 43 years. He was an avid Iowa Hawkeye fan and enjoyed watching Westerns. Above all, Leon loved spending time with his family, especially his granddaughters.

Those left to cherish Leon's memory include his daughters, Lisa (Noel) Anderson and Vicki Blair; grandchildren, Nicole (Jayson) Blanchard, Sydney (John Jr.) Mosley, and Lauren Anderson; and great-grandchildren, Jayton, Nikkolay, Athena, Anastasia, and Atlas.

Leon was preceded in death by his parents; wife, Marietta; infant daughter, Cynthia Schrader; and brothers, William, Donald, and Duane Schrader.
